The specific ownership tax was enacted in 1937 and is contained in article x, section 6, of the colorado constitution. It is imposed on cars, trucks, trailers, mobile homes, and special mobile machinery. The annual specific ownership tax is based on the year of service.
The Tax Is Based On The Value Of The Vehicle And Is Paid Each Year That A Vehicle Is Registered In Colorado.
The ownership tax rate is assessed on the original taxable value and year of service Current law uses the manufacturer's suggested retail price (msrp) of a vehicle to determine taxable value, which is used to determine the amount of the specific ownership tax. Specific ownership taxes on vehicles taxable value for passenger vehicles is 85 percent of the msrp (manufacturer's suggested retail price);
In Colorado, We Pay A Specific Ownership Tax Each Year When We Renew Our Car Registration.
Vehicles do not need to be operated in order to be assessed this tax. On and after july 1, 2020, the bill modifies the rates of specific ownership tax imposed on motor vehicles, commercial trailers, and special mobile machinery that is less than 25 years old, increasing the total amount of specific ownership tax revenue collected. Denver, tuesday, march 12, 2019 ‚äì the colorado division of motor vehicles, in conjunction with colorado counties, has established a refund process for those individuals affected by a specific ownership tax (sot) miscalculation which caused them to pay a higher sot rate when they renewed their motor vehicle registration. Specific ownership taxes (sot) o these taxes are based on the year of manufacture of the vehicle and the original taxable value, which is determined when the vehicle is new and does not change throughout the life of the vehicle.
